LVN



* Patient Care:
+ Administer medications and treatments as prescribed by the healthcare provider.
+ Monitor patients' vital signs and report any changes in condition to the RN or physician.
+ Assist in developing and implementing individualized care plans for residents.
+ Provide basic nursing care, including wound care, catheter care, and assisting with daily living activities.
+ Ensure patient comfort and safety by responding promptly to call lights and addressing patient needs.


* Documentation and Communication:
+ Accurately document patient care, observations, and interventions in the medical record.
+ Maintain open and effective communication with patients, families, and the healthcare team.
+ Participate in shift handoffs to ensure continuity of care.


* Team Collaboration:
+ Work collaboratively with RNs, CNAs, and other healthcare professionals to deliver comprehensive care.
+ Assist with the training and orientation of new staff members as needed.
+ Participate in care conferences and contribute to the interdisciplinary team's decision-making process.


* Compliance and Safety:
+ Adhere to all facility policies, procedures, and regulations, including those related to infection control and resident rights.
+ Ensure proper use of medical equipment and report any malfunctions to appropriate personnel.
+ Maintain a clean, safe, and organized work environment.

Qualifications:


* Education: Graduate of an accredited LVN program.


* Licensure: Current and valid LVN license in the state of California.


* Experience: Prior experience in a skilled nursing or post-acute care facility is preferred.


* Certifications: BLS (Basic Life Support) certification required.


* Skills:
+ Strong clinical and critical thinking skills.
+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
+ Ability to work effectively in a fast-paced environment.
+ Proficiency in electronic medical records (EMR) systems is a plus.

Physical Requirements:


* Ability to lift and move patients as required.


* Prolonged periods of standing and walking.


* Ability to perform physically demanding tasks, such as repositioning patients.
